Inter-Religious Dialogue, and Qur'anic Arguments

Rob is joined by ABD Luis Dizon, who’s at the University of Toronto. They talk a bit about his up bringing in the Philippines, inter-religious work - including bridge-building areas between Christians and Muslims, as well as working some “proofs” of the Qur’an’s divinity from a Muslim perspective, ending with best Qur’ans to read for beginners.
